Alibag Assembly Election Result 2019

Maharashtra · Vidhan Sabha (State Assembly) Election 2019

Mahendra Hari Dalvi of Shiv Sena won the Alibag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ency in Maharashtra in the 2019 state assembly election, securing 111,946 votes (52.70% vote share). The runner-up was Subhash Alias Panditshet Patil (Peasants And Workers Party Of India) with 79,022 votes.

A total of 13 candidates contested this assembly seat. Position Candidate Name Votes Votes% Party
1 Mahendra Hari Dalvi 111946 52.70% Shiv Sena
2 Subhash Alias Panditshet Patil 79022 37.20% Peasants And Workers Party Of India
3 Rajendra Madhukar Thakur Alias Rajabhau Thakur 11891 5.60% Independent
4 Ashraf Latif Ghatte 2920 1.40% Independent
5 Adv. Thakur Shraddha Mahesh 2526 1.20% Indian National Congress
6 Ravikant Ramchandra Perekar 1139 0.50% Vanchit Bahujan Aaghadi
7 Anil Baban Gaikwad 756 0.40% Bahujan Samaj Party
8 Chintaman Laxman Patil 725 0.30% Independent
9 Shrinivas Satyanarayan Mattaparti 414 0.20% Independent
10 Dinkar Ganpat Khariwle 366 0.20% Independent
11 Sandeep Bapu Sarang 359 0.20% Lok Bharati
12 Hemlata Ramnath Patil 303 0.10% Prahar Janshakti Party
13 Anand Ranganath Naik 145 0.10% Independent
